Shutdown requirements in space of the Space Shuttle Main Engines require that the low pressure pump operate under conditions of zero flow and zero NPSH and still be able to generate head and absorb torque. Ground tests were conducted in both water and liquid oxygen to verify these capabilities. The test facilities are described, and the test results are presented showing the pump performance at zero flow over a wide range of NPSH conditions including zero values. The influence of operating speed, fluid medium, and internal struts upstream of the inducer are presented. A flow model schematic is presented sketching a flow field in the pump that is consistent with the observed data.
